Sentences with phrase «pr teams setting up»

Even those with PR teams setting up readings for them need to put in time and effort to visit stores, do readings and signings, and participate in Q&A sessions.
It's much swankier and more expensive (their PR team set us up).

Not exact matches

Last week, San Francisco - based Slack announced a new shared channel feature that will let workgroups at different companies — which must be paid Slack accounts — set up shared channels, thus enabling a marketing team at a company work in a channel with their advertising or PR agency.
Or maybe it really was a set - up and the PR team are doing their best to cover it up.
«Jay set up the company to maintain continuity of leadership and daily operations through the executive management team,» said Vivian Hood, Jaffe PR's executive vice president, Client Services, and a member of the executive committee.
a b c d e f g h i j k l m n o p q r s t u v w x y z